Blackhawks Assign Laurent Brossoit to Rockford
The Chicago Blackhawks today announced that the team has assigned goaltender Laurent Brossoit to the Rockford IceHogs of the American Hockey League.
Brossoit, 32, has posted a 2-1-0 record, a .900 save percentage and a 3.39 goals-against average in three games with the IceHogs this season. He also scored his first professional goal on Dec. 12 against Milwaukee.
